The ingredients needed to make Baingan Kasuri Methi Pakoras:
  1. Take Gram Flour or Besan
  2. Get dried Fenugreek Leaves
  3. Prepare Salt
  4. Take Brinjals or Eggplants sliced medium thick
  5. Take Red chilli powder
  6. Take Cumin powder
  7. Get Turmeric powder
  8. Prepare Dry Mango powder or Amchur
  9. Prepare Asafoetida
  10. Take Baking Soda
  11. Get Water
  12. Get Oil for frying

Instructions to make Baingan Kasuri Methi Pakoras:
  1. Make a smooth lump free semi-thick batter with all the ingredients mentioned. Cover and set aside for 20 minutes. Wash the Fenugreek Leaves under running water in a strainer before adding them to the batter.
  2. Heat oil on medium-high heat and dip the slices into the batter and see to it that they are evenly coated. Deep fry on both sides until done. Serve them piping hot with any Chutney of your choice. These can be served with Boiled Rice and Daal too as a condiment or an accompaniment. It's a lovely one indeed.
